Bitcoin Mining Facility Faces Shutdown Over Noise Complaints

Rural Delaware County residents are pushing for the shutdown of a Bitcoin mining facility after it began operating on land zoned for agricultural use. The Compass Mining facility, located just west of Hopkinton, has been generating noise that neighbors say is disrupting their lives.

Compass Mining needs to rezone the land from agricultural to light industrial use to continue operating. However, the Delaware County Zoning Commission recommended denying this request. If denied, the facility will have to shut down.

Randy Fitzgerald, a neighbor of the facility, described the noise as sounding like a 'jet engine' coming from the south of his property. He believes that the use of the land is inappropriate and thinks it should be shut down immediately.
